On Mon, 04 Sep 2000, Terry wrote:
> Hi back.  Sound in KDE2 does require the Alsa sound libs in order to work.
> The libs are very strict about which kernel your using to. A mismatched
> libalsa with the wrong kernel version will not get you sound.
